Output 3bcbafea23be5fdf3c1e2b576d903e695f1535525eef2fa0abd96fc4dd84c3dc:0

value
305676
script pubkey
OP_0 OP_PUSHBYTES_20 4e26d32245f956b56817c5088de977fdb62e3005
address
bc1qfcndxgj9l9tt26qhc5ygm6thlkmzuvq9mzdgft
transaction
3bcbafea23be5fdf3c1e2b576d903e695f1535525eef2fa0abd96fc4dd84c3dc
confirmations
120453
spent
true